Why this part is needed
Daily use wears the button, spring, and hook. When the latch weakens, the console compartment door may pop open over bumps, spill contents, or creak. Replacing the latch improves comfort, protects the hinge, and maintains interior fit and finish—great for Corolla, Camry, RAV4, and other Toyota models.
How it works ⚙️
The push-button drives a cam that retracts a steel pawl from the striker. A coil spring returns the pawl to the ready position; when you shut the lid, the hook snaps over the catch with a positive click. The housing guides movement to prevent side load and reduces squeaks.
What happens if it’s broken ❗
Symptoms include a lid that won’t stay shut, sticky button action, rattles, or a cracked pivot. If ignored, the loose lid stresses the hinge, mars trim, and can distract the driver. In some trims, nearby USB/12V wiring or console lighting can also get tugged.
